    George Washington Sailors Take Daily Weather Readings

    Aerographer’s Mate Airman Brendan Tuz, from Norfolk, Virginia, and Aerographer’s Mate Airman Apprentice Diego Alverio, from Everett, Washington, both assigned to intelligence department, train using a gyrocompass to determine the direction of waves aboard Nimitz-class aircraft carrier USS George Washington (CVN 73) while underway in the Philippine Sea, May 30, 2025. George Washington is the U.S. Navy’s premier forward-deployed aircraft carrier, a long-standing symbol of the United States’ commitment to maintaining a free and open Indo-Pacific region, while operating alongside allies and partners across the U.S. Navy’s largest numbered fleet.
